Would you consider a wide array of sensors as equivalent or a prerequisite at a minimum for that "vast array of prior, abstract knowledge?" I'd argue that we don't have nearly enough "sensory" data to even start to approach the General Intelligence problem.
-
Agreed. IMHO what we humans call intelligence are those behaviors that allow us to survive and thrive in the real world; in short, the human-centric definition of intelligence assumes embodiment. And as such, alien species would have very different measures of intelligence.
